About Basara Saraswati Temple
Basara, also known as Gnana Saraswati Temple, is situated along the banks of the Godavari River in Telangana. It is one of the rare temples in India dedicated to Goddess Saraswati, along with Lakshmi and Kali.
The calm surroundings and divine atmosphere make it an ideal place for performing educational rituals for children.

What is Aksharabhyasam?
Aksharabhyasam is a traditional Hindu ritual that symbolizes the beginning of a child’s education. During this ceremony, the child writes their first letters under the guidance of parents and priests.
This ritual represents:
- The start of learning
- Blessings from Goddess Saraswati
- A positive foundation for academic growth
👉 Ideal age: 2 to 5 years

Basara Aksharabhyasam Timings
Daily Timings:
- Morning: 7:30 AM – 12:00 PM
- Afternoon: 2:00 PM – 6:00 PM
👉 Morning sessions are usually less crowded and more comfortable for children.
Peak Days:
- Vasant Panchami
- Dussehra
- Akshaya Tritiya
These days attract large crowds, so plan accordingly.
Step-by-Step Aksharabhyasam Procedure
The process at Basara temple is simple and well-organized:
1. Ticket Purchase
You need to buy a ticket at the temple counter.
2. Seating Arrangement
Families are guided to a designated area where the ritual is performed.
3. Writing Ritual
- The child writes “Om” or first letters on rice or a slate
- Parents assist by holding the child’s hand
4. Priest Blessings
Priests chant mantras and bless the child for a bright future.
👉 Duration: Around 20 minutes
Ticket Price & Booking Details
- Ticket cost: ₹100 to ₹300 (approx.)
- Booking mode: Offline (at temple counter)
👉 No prior online booking is usually required.

How to Reach Basara Temple
By Train
Basara has its own railway station with good connectivity.
By Bus
Regular buses are available from Hyderabad and nearby cities.
By Road
Distance from Hyderabad is around 210 km, making it a comfortable road trip.
